RTCOutboundRtpStreamStats: nackCount property
The nackCount property of the
RTCOutboundRtpStreamStats dictionary is a numeric value indicating the
number of times the RTCRtpSender described by this object received a
NACK packet from the remote receiver.
A NACK (Negative
ACKnowledgement, also called "Generic NACK") packet is used by the
RTCRtpReceiver to inform the sender that one or more RTP
packets it sent were lost in transport.
Value
An integer value indicating how many times the sender received a NACK packet from the receiver, indicating the loss of one or more packets.
